鄧其貴,韋 敏,蔣愛榮
(1.柳州職業(yè)技術(shù)學(xué)院,廣西 柳州 545036;2.百色職業(yè)學(xué)院,廣西 百色 533000)
計(jì)算機(jī)技術(shù)的發(fā)展推動(dòng)著模具生產(chǎn)行業(yè)實(shí)現(xiàn)新的產(chǎn)能革命,以智能化數(shù)控機(jī)床為載體,模具生產(chǎn)愈發(fā)趨于規(guī)模化,真正實(shí)現(xiàn)了計(jì)算機(jī)輔助制造的技術(shù)構(gòu)想。模具生產(chǎn)在經(jīng)歷周期縮短、技術(shù)改造、工藝優(yōu)化等革新后,將合理提升模具企業(yè)的生產(chǎn)效率,確保模具為制造業(yè)的發(fā)展推波助瀾。很多模具的成型都會(huì)產(chǎn)生大量的參數(shù),這些參數(shù)是控制和提升模具精度的重要標(biāo)尺。要進(jìn)一步保障模具生產(chǎn)的效率與質(zhì)量,必然需要將一些慣用參數(shù)作為歷史經(jīng)驗(yàn)數(shù)據(jù)進(jìn)行打包歸集,這就需要建設(shè)和持續(xù)擴(kuò)容工藝數(shù)據(jù)庫(kù)。模具生產(chǎn)引入計(jì)算機(jī)輔助制造工藝以來,其計(jì)算機(jī)輔助制造工藝數(shù)據(jù)庫(kù)即CAM 數(shù)據(jù)庫(kù)的建設(shè)也成為眾多研究者的重點(diǎn)關(guān)注課題。
模具CAM,是模具計(jì)算機(jī)輔助制造之代稱,內(nèi)涵是利用計(jì)算機(jī)的強(qiáng)大功能來輔助模具制造系統(tǒng),實(shí)現(xiàn)從生產(chǎn)準(zhǔn)備到產(chǎn)品成型全過程的輔助,將計(jì)算機(jī)與各種產(chǎn)品制造過程以及相關(guān)設(shè)備實(shí)施直接或間接性關(guān)聯(lián),讓計(jì)算機(jī)系統(tǒng)加強(qiáng)對(duì)不同階段所產(chǎn)圖形、數(shù)據(jù)、作業(yè)計(jì)劃、生產(chǎn)進(jìn)度等內(nèi)容整合,強(qiáng)化各種過程控制與操作運(yùn)行,借助各種資源的轉(zhuǎn)化,以特定信息流的方式作用于全生產(chǎn)系統(tǒng),完成產(chǎn)品數(shù)據(jù)處理、物料流動(dòng)控制以及產(chǎn)品性能檢測(cè)等。模具CAM 既可優(yōu)化勞動(dòng)生產(chǎn)效率,又能降低制造成本,進(jìn)一步簡(jiǎn)化生產(chǎn)復(fù)雜度,縮減周期,確保高質(zhì)量的生產(chǎn)過程同時(shí)具備要素可調(diào)試的生產(chǎn)柔性。
模具生產(chǎn)CAM 工藝數(shù)據(jù)庫(kù)常以四種模型出現(xiàn),分別是:層次模型、網(wǎng)絡(luò)模型、關(guān)系模型、面向?qū)ο竽P停瑢?duì)應(yīng)的模型示例如圖1 和圖2 所示。

圖1 層次模型的結(jié)構(gòu)

圖2 網(wǎng)絡(luò)模型的結(jié)構(gòu)
綜上對(duì)比,以面向?qū)ο竽P蛠硗瓿傻哪>呱a(chǎn)CAM 工藝數(shù)據(jù)庫(kù)的效果最佳。首先,面向?qū)ο竽P涂蛇m用于不同的數(shù)據(jù)類型,該數(shù)據(jù)庫(kù)中的數(shù)據(jù)可以有不同的屬性,無論是文本數(shù)字圖片格式還是視頻音頻,都可以以面向?qū)ο竽P蛠眢w現(xiàn),可為數(shù)據(jù)庫(kù)的處理提供更大的集成應(yīng)用開發(fā)系統(tǒng);其次,面向?qū)ο竽P途邆淅^承、多態(tài)和動(dòng)態(tài)綁定等強(qiáng)大功能特性,不同的用戶在引入模型開發(fā)過程中,能夠降低對(duì)特定對(duì)象的代碼編寫要求,真正成為簡(jiǎn)化流程的對(duì)象構(gòu)成方案,較好地為客戶提供解決方案,讓用戶能夠真正體會(huì)到快捷便利高性能的程序開效率;其三,面向?qū)ο竽P蛯?duì)于數(shù)據(jù)的訪問方式設(shè)定有兩種,可支持關(guān)聯(lián)式與導(dǎo)航式,因此對(duì)數(shù)據(jù)的訪問性能會(huì)更加出色。事實(shí)證明,面向?qū)ο竽P涂蔀橛脩籼幚砭哂卸嘣獙哟蔚臄?shù)據(jù)提供更加便捷的服務(wù),同時(shí)能夠?qū)τ脩襞R時(shí)定義的數(shù)據(jù)類型進(jìn)行必要的邏輯學(xué)習(xí),支持以新數(shù)據(jù)類型來完成對(duì)應(yīng)的目標(biāo)操作與改進(jìn)性分析,面向?qū)ο竽P湍軌蚣皶r(shí)修改或重新定義來自系統(tǒng)更新數(shù)據(jù)的模式評(píng)價(jià),其能力靈活,可在數(shù)據(jù)庫(kù)系統(tǒng)中發(fā)揮強(qiáng)大的管理能力,特別是能夠?yàn)橛脩舨煌枨蟮墓ぷ魈峁└斜U闲缘墓ぷ鹘涌凇?/p>
大量生產(chǎn)實(shí)踐表明,模具CAM 能夠基于合理模型的搭配應(yīng)用展現(xiàn)如下特點(diǎn):
1)模具生產(chǎn)可以直接從設(shè)計(jì)與生產(chǎn)階段所設(shè)定的任務(wù)指揮中心取得各種可行數(shù)據(jù),同時(shí)加載更多符合關(guān)鍵詞定義范圍的圖文資料,通過計(jì)算機(jī)的強(qiáng)大邏輯運(yùn)算,快速開展工藝與生產(chǎn)方面的作業(yè),極大地縮減在工藝與生產(chǎn)階段的準(zhǔn)備時(shí)間。
2)CAM使用計(jì)算機(jī)作為主控單元,能夠通過軟件編程與硬件動(dòng)作記憶等機(jī)制不斷調(diào)整整個(gè)模具生產(chǎn)過程,使得生產(chǎn)過程更加合理有序,質(zhì)量與效益得到雙保障。
3)計(jì)算機(jī)輔助制造系統(tǒng)中,各種數(shù)據(jù)匯集的信息流在傳輸中體現(xiàn)出了節(jié)點(diǎn)定位的準(zhǔn)確性,使得信息響應(yīng)與反饋機(jī)制更加及時(shí)準(zhǔn)確。
4)大量工藝設(shè)計(jì)與生產(chǎn)等工作環(huán)節(jié)可通過計(jì)算機(jī)控制機(jī)械裝置來完成,直接降低技術(shù)工作人員的工作壓力,管理人員通過各種監(jiān)控檢測(cè)系統(tǒng)維持整個(gè)生產(chǎn)的持續(xù)性運(yùn)行。
模具生產(chǎn)的計(jì)算機(jī)輔助制造工藝數(shù)據(jù)庫(kù)的建設(shè)過程中,還需要準(zhǔn)確掌握成組工藝技術(shù)的概念與特性。成組技術(shù)主要是指一旦制造產(chǎn)品進(jìn)入生產(chǎn)階段后,將具有相近特性與規(guī)格特征的零部件進(jìn)行必要的分組,要求先編碼定位再判別分類,重新分類的零件與其他相似件間可組成一個(gè)零件族。計(jì)算機(jī)輔助制造過程中,將默認(rèn)以零件族作為識(shí)別標(biāo)準(zhǔn)積極展開加工,如此必然屬于盡可能限制和優(yōu)化生產(chǎn)批次,并主動(dòng)擴(kuò)容單批次生產(chǎn)量,以高效法獲得高效益,充分體現(xiàn)出了加工近似零件的優(yōu)越性。成組技術(shù)原理圖如圖3所示。

圖3 成組技術(shù)工藝原理圖
成組技術(shù)的應(yīng)用一般會(huì)出現(xiàn)在眾多產(chǎn)品的中小批量化生產(chǎn)中。模具產(chǎn)品的生產(chǎn),正是典型的中小批量甚至單件生產(chǎn),因此采用成組技術(shù)便顯得十分妥帖合理。利用計(jì)算機(jī)的運(yùn)行操作,模具生產(chǎn)中零件的各種分類以及編碼等工作都會(huì)更有效率。計(jì)算機(jī)輔助制造工藝數(shù)據(jù)庫(kù)的建立,能夠?yàn)槌山M技術(shù)提供基礎(chǔ)數(shù)據(jù)、核心數(shù)據(jù),提高對(duì)各種零件的編碼、判別、分類等環(huán)節(jié)的精確性,為有序?qū)嵤┏山M技術(shù),有序運(yùn)行模具計(jì)算機(jī)輔助制造奠定堅(jiān)實(shí)的基礎(chǔ)。
模具生產(chǎn)計(jì)算機(jī)輔助制造工藝數(shù)據(jù)庫(kù)的建設(shè)思想是以計(jì)算機(jī)作為重要技術(shù)支撐和平臺(tái),整個(gè)模具的設(shè)計(jì)方案、規(guī)格數(shù)據(jù)、圖形圖表、工藝參數(shù)、作業(yè)計(jì)劃、刀具軌跡程序等信息數(shù)據(jù)及其相互關(guān)系都能夠被記錄在計(jì)算機(jī)存儲(chǔ)空間中,通過富有邏輯的數(shù)據(jù)信息來展示各要素的內(nèi)在關(guān)聯(lián)性,并且通過專業(yè)處理軟件來強(qiáng)化對(duì)不同數(shù)據(jù)的存儲(chǔ)、讀取、整合與管理,確保模具的計(jì)算機(jī)輔助制造生產(chǎn)滿足各種工業(yè)需求。
模具生產(chǎn)的計(jì)算機(jī)輔助制造工藝數(shù)據(jù)庫(kù)的構(gòu)建過程中,應(yīng)當(dāng)準(zhǔn)確把握數(shù)據(jù)庫(kù)系統(tǒng)中的數(shù)據(jù)變換要求和具體情況。數(shù)據(jù)庫(kù)系統(tǒng)會(huì)選擇雙層變換時(shí),首先考慮到數(shù)據(jù)冗余量的問題,計(jì)算機(jī)輔助制造系統(tǒng)出于強(qiáng)化數(shù)據(jù)共享的目的,主動(dòng)將不同用戶數(shù)據(jù)進(jìn)行聚合,并通過必要的算法或邏輯抽象出具有統(tǒng)一形態(tài)的數(shù)據(jù)流圖;其次是考慮到數(shù)據(jù)庫(kù)的存儲(chǔ)效率,并且要不斷優(yōu)化存儲(chǔ)性能,系統(tǒng)會(huì)將所有數(shù)據(jù)按照物理組織最優(yōu)化形式來實(shí)行存儲(chǔ)。可見,在模具計(jì)算機(jī)輔助制造的工藝數(shù)據(jù)庫(kù)中,用戶模型、數(shù)據(jù)模型以及系統(tǒng)內(nèi)部模型都是彼此互通,相互轉(zhuǎn)化的。在數(shù)據(jù)庫(kù)中,用戶模型又稱之為子模式,數(shù)據(jù)模型稱之為模式,而內(nèi)部模型稱之為是物理模式。通過三種模式之間的相互轉(zhuǎn)化,各種資源才能實(shí)現(xiàn)合理化利用,數(shù)據(jù)庫(kù)中的數(shù)據(jù)也才能真正體現(xiàn)其價(jià)值,在便捷有序的存取中發(fā)揮最大化作用。
某企業(yè)在模具制造方面能力較強(qiáng),屬于行業(yè)內(nèi)的領(lǐng)軍者。多年來,已經(jīng)通過資金的合理投資引入了先進(jìn)的設(shè)備,并在技術(shù)方面不斷優(yōu)化,達(dá)到了國(guó)內(nèi)一流國(guó)際領(lǐng)先水平。目前,該企業(yè)的模具加工中心已具有較強(qiáng)的生產(chǎn)能力,有先進(jìn)的引進(jìn)設(shè)備和精良的技術(shù),主要的數(shù)控設(shè)備資產(chǎn)及模具年生產(chǎn)情況見表1。

表1 某企業(yè)內(nèi)部主要數(shù)控設(shè)備資產(chǎn)及模具年生產(chǎn)情況統(tǒng)計(jì)清單
企業(yè)在應(yīng)對(duì)激烈市場(chǎng)競(jìng)爭(zhēng)的過程中,主動(dòng)投入更大的技術(shù)、資金等資源開發(fā)自有產(chǎn)品,擴(kuò)大產(chǎn)品的市場(chǎng)占有率。在生產(chǎn)軍民品種方面,極力發(fā)揮大而全的競(jìng)爭(zhēng)優(yōu)勢(shì)。如拓展了摩托車的生產(chǎn)型號(hào),現(xiàn)有50 型、55 型、60 型、80 型、150 型等五個(gè)型號(hào),對(duì)產(chǎn)品精度的考驗(yàn)與要求十分嚴(yán)格。為滿足生產(chǎn)需要,在生產(chǎn)計(jì)劃中安排復(fù)雜模具制造的大部分工作量由加工中心和數(shù)控機(jī)床來完成,企業(yè)技術(shù)人員為了充分發(fā)揮加工中心與數(shù)控機(jī)床的工作效率,首先花費(fèi)一定的前期時(shí)間開發(fā)了部分模具的計(jì)算機(jī)輔助制造工藝數(shù)據(jù)庫(kù),主動(dòng)分析整個(gè)工藝過程,積極調(diào)整其中的不同要素,優(yōu)化過程消耗,縮減數(shù)控程序編制時(shí)間,努力提升模具制造質(zhì)量。針對(duì)模具型面項(xiàng)目開發(fā)過程中,技術(shù)人員會(huì)先將參考模具的型面進(jìn)行可視化分解,突出其中的基本型面,如平面、圓柱面、圓錐面、球面、擬合曲面等,這樣復(fù)雜模具實(shí)體就可看作是眾多基本型面的組合,從而將這些基本型面分解后建立必要的制造工藝數(shù)據(jù)庫(kù),通過數(shù)據(jù)庫(kù)得到優(yōu)化的NC與CNC程序,充分發(fā)揮計(jì)算機(jī)輔助制造的功能。
現(xiàn)代工業(yè)的發(fā)展離不開模具的生產(chǎn)制造,為了進(jìn)一步提升模具生產(chǎn)制造的質(zhì)量與效率,有必要研究建設(shè)模具生產(chǎn)的計(jì)算機(jī)輔助制造工藝數(shù)據(jù)庫(kù)。本文對(duì)如何正確選用數(shù)據(jù)庫(kù)中的構(gòu)建模型,探討研究其中的數(shù)據(jù)管理技術(shù)進(jìn)行研究,實(shí)現(xiàn)了各種數(shù)據(jù)流的動(dòng)態(tài)循環(huán),發(fā)揮最大化的數(shù)據(jù)應(yīng)用價(jià)值,推進(jìn)了計(jì)算機(jī)輔助設(shè)計(jì)在制造業(yè)領(lǐng)域的應(yīng)用,為現(xiàn)代制造業(yè)發(fā)展提供了理論支撐。